Abstract:
PURPOSE: A device and a method for a multi-layer parallel processing lookup in a communication system are provided to apply a CAM(Content Addressable Memory) to simultaneously and independently process the lookup of a 2-layer MAC(Medium Access Control) address and a 3-layer IP(Internet Protocol) address in order to implement a fast lookup satisfying a gigabit speed of traffic. CONSTITUTION: An MAC(Medium Access Control,41) performs protocol processing for a gigabit speed of signal received from an Ethernet physical medium, and delivers a packet frame inside a system through an inner receiving FIFO(First-In-First-Out). In a lookup control unit(42) an address recognizer(421) latches a header of a gigabit capacity of packet data frame received from the receiving FIFO of the MAC(41) in real time, to extract necessary information. A 2-layer lookup controller(422) controls a 2-layer CAM(Content Addressable Memory)(423) and searches output network information, to obtain lookup information on an MAC address processed in a 2-layer among the extracted information. A 3-layer lookup controller(424) controls a 3-layer CAM(425) and searches output network information, to obtain lookup information on an IP(Internet Protocol) address processed in a 3-layer among the extracted information. A forwarding transmission unit(426) transmits the output network information obtained from the 2-layer and 3-layer lookup controllers(422,424) to a forwarding unit(43).
Abstract:
본 발명은 분산된 가입자 엑세스 망(DANS) 관리 메니저 시스템(DOMS)에서 공통관리 인터페이스 프로토콜(CMIP)통신을 이용하여 각 DANS의 에이전트를 통한 가입자 관리방법에 관한 것으로서, 현재 지형적으로 분산 설치 및 운영되고 있는 비동기식 가입자 엑세스 망(DANS)을 통해 제공되는 서비스의 가입자를 운용자가 원거리에서 통합적으로 관리하는 방법을 제공하는데 있다. 이를 위하여 본 발명은 표준 관리 정보 베이스(MIB)를 기초로 하고, CMIP을 사용한 에이전트와의 인터페이스를 통하여 DOMS에서 서비스 가입자에 대한 운용자의 등록 기능과 각 DANS에서 발생되는 가입자 관리 이벤트를 에이전트를 통하여 전달받아 이를 처리하는 기능을 수행한다.
Abstract:
본 발명은 현재의 집중형 액세스 노드 시스템(CANS)에서 수행되는 구성관리 기능외에 망관리 시스템에서 단순망관리규약(SNMP)을 이용하여 원격지의 CANS 시스템에 대한 구성관리 기능을 수행하는 방법을 제공하는데 그 목적이 있다. 상기 목적을 달성하기 위해 본 발명은, 원격지 구성관리 기능을 제공하기 위해 원격지 망관리 시스템에 대한 초기화(30)가 수행되면, 망관리 시스템에 입력되는 사건(Event)별로 수행될 콜백루틴을 예약(31)하는 제1단계와, 콜백루틴에 대한 예약이 끝나면 포트 및 보드에 대한 상태 정보 요구 주기를 설정(32)하고, 시스템에 사건이 입력될 때까지 사건발생을 대기(33)하는 제2단계와, 앞서 설정된 포트 및 보드 상태 정보 요구 주기가 경과하여 자동적으로 설정주기 경과 사건(Event)이 발생되면, 원격지 망관리 시스템(2)내의 구성관리부(18)에서 상기 사건을 수신(34)하는 제3단계와, 원격지의 집중형 액세스 노드 시스템(CANS; 1)에서 보드 및 포트의 상태를 읽어오는 제4단계(45 내지 51)와, 읽어온 상태 정보를 분석하여 망관리 화면(26)에 출력하는 제5단계(57 내지 67) 를 포함한다.
Abstract:
본 발명은 광대역 종합정보통신망(이하 B-ISDN이라 함)에서 가입자간 또는 가입자와 망간에 온-디멘드(on-demand) 서비스를 제공해 주기 위한 집중형 액세스 노드 시스템의 호 중계방법에 관한 것으로, 호 설정 요구가 수신되면, 수신 포트에 대한 호 정보와 착신자의 주소를 이용한 출력 포트에 따라 수신 포트 또는 출력 포트에 대한 호 수락 여부를 결정하여 수신 포트에 호 해제 응답 요구(RELEASE COMPLETGE)를 하거나 출력 포트에 호 설정 요구(SETUP)를 하는 제1단계(21∼28); 루트로부터 파티 추가 요구신호를 수신하면 출력 포트에 대한 호의 존재 여부와 호 수락 여부에 따라 출력 포트에 파티 추가 요구(ADD PARTY) 또는 호 설정 요구(SETUP)를 하거나 루트 파티에게 파티 추가 거절 요구(ADD PARTY REJECT)를 하는 제2단계(29∼39); 발신측 포트로부터 호 해제 요구를 수신하면 점대다중점 호인지 확인하여 다중점 호에 연결된 모든 출력호에 대해 호 해제 요구(RELEASE)를 하는 제3단계(40∼48); 착신측 포트로부터 호 해제 요구를 수신하면 점대다중점 호 여부와, 루트 포트에 해당호에 참여하는 파티의 수에 따라 루트 포트에 파티 삭제 요구(DROP PARTY)를 하거나 호 해제 요구(RELEASE)를 하는 제4단계(49∼57); 및 루트로부터 파티 제거 요구를 수신하면 출력 포트에 해당하는 호에 참여하고 있는 파티 수와 출력호 존재여부에 따라 리프 파티 삭제 요구(DROP PARTY)를 하거나 출력 포트에 호 해제 요구(RELEASE)를 하는 제5단계(58∼69)를 포함하는 것을 특징으로 하여 가입자간 온-디멘드(on-demand) 서비스를 제공할 수 있을 뿐만 아니라 가입자와 망간의 온-디멘드(on-demand) 서비스를 저렴한 가격으로 제공할 수 있으며, 망의 자원을 효율적으로 사용할 수 있는 효과가 있다.
Abstract:
본 발명은 비동기 전달방식(이하, ATM이라 칭함) 액세스 노드 시스템에서 발생할 수 있는 경보를 감지하여 시스템의 원활한 서비스를 가능하게 하는 ATM 노드 시스템에서의 경보 감지 및 처리방법에 관한 것으로, 경보 발생 처리과정은, 경보가 발생하면 해당 시스템 구성 요소 객체(4)를 찾아 경보 상황과 경보 심각도에 따라 경보 발생 정보를 로그하는 제1단계; 및 상기 구성요소의 경보 상태를 운용자나 망관리 시스템 또는 그 인터페이스부(7)로 보고하고 경보 심각도에 따라 장애 격리를 수행하도록 하는 제2단계를 포함하고, 경보 해제 처리 과정은, 경보 해제가 검출되면 해당 시스템 구성요소 객체(4)를 찾아 경보 상황과 경보 해제 조건에 따라 경보 해제 정보를 로그하는 제3단계; 및 경보 해제 결과를 운용자나 망관리 시스템 또는 그 인터페이스부(7)에 보고하고 현재 경보의 심각도에 따라 장애 복구를 수행하도록 하는 제4단계를 포함하는 것을 특지으로 하여 시스템의 원활한 서비스를 가능하게 하며, 시스템 및 통신망을 보호하는 효과가 있다.
Abstract:
본 발명은 집중형 액세스 노드 시스템(CANS)의 장애 관리 기능을 실행하는 장애 관리 방법에 관한 것으로, 원격지의 망관리 시스템에서 단순망관리규약(SNMP)를 이용하여 집중형 액세스 노드 시스템(CANS)에 발생한 장애를 파악할 수 있는 장애 관리 방법을 제공하기 위하여, 시스템을 초기화하고 사건(EVENT)별로 수행될 콜백루틴을 예약하고 장애 정보 수신을 위한 초기화 과정을 수행한 후에 사건 발생을 대기하는 제 1단계(30 내지 33); 상기 제 1단계(30 내지 33)의 대기 상태에서 장애 정보 사건(EVENT)를 수신하면, 장애 정보를 분석하여 화면에 장애 상태를 표시한 후에 장애 정보를 저장하는 제 2단계(34,37 내지 57); 및 상기 제 1단계(30 내지 33)의 대기 상태에서 장애 정보 출력 요청 사건(EVENT)를 수신하면, 저장된 장애 정보를 출력하는 제 3단계(35,58 내지 63)를 포함하여 집중형 액세스 노드 시스템의 장애 관리를 위한 인력 및 시간을 줄일 수 있는 효과가 있다.
Abstract:
PURPOSE: A device and a method for a multi-layer parallel processing lookup in a communication system are provided to apply a CAM(Content Addressable Memory) to simultaneously and independently process the lookup of a 2-layer MAC(Medium Access Control) address and a 3-layer IP(Internet Protocol) address in order to implement a fast lookup satisfying a gigabit speed of traffic. CONSTITUTION: An MAC(Medium Access Control,41) performs protocol processing for a gigabit speed of signal received from an Ethernet physical medium, and delivers a packet frame inside a system through an inner receiving FIFO(First-In-First-Out). In a lookup control unit(42) an address recognizer(421) latches a header of a gigabit capacity of packet data frame received from the receiving FIFO of the MAC(41) in real time, to extract necessary information. A 2-layer lookup controller(422) controls a 2-layer CAM(Content Addressable Memory)(423) and searches output network information, to obtain lookup information on an MAC address processed in a 2-layer among the extracted information. A 3-layer lookup controller(424) controls a 3-layer CAM(425) and searches output network information, to obtain lookup information on an IP(Internet Protocol) address processed in a 3-layer among the extracted information. A forwarding transmission unit(426) transmits the output network information obtained from the 2-layer and 3-layer lookup controllers(422,424) to a forwarding unit(43).
Abstract:
PURPOSE: A multidimensional packet classification method is provided to achieve extensity to a large-sized system having a great quantity of packet classification rules and to apply to various protocol fields by classifying packets after forming a tree for packet classification rules. CONSTITUTION: The number of packet classification rules 'i' and the number of fields 's' are initialized as '0'(301). A variable 'N' memorizes route nodes only(302). A filed to be executed presently is selected(303). A deterministic rule is carried out to form portions marked with dot lines. Along the links designated as '0' and '1' links are generated if there is no link(304). All nodes that are encountered along all possible links to '*' are stored(305). The number of fields 's' is increased by '1'(306). If all possible nodes that can go along links are stored, nodes that can become start points when a next field is added are stored(307). If is confirmed whether processing for one given rule finished(308). If processing for one given rule finished, the number of packet classification rules 'i' is increased by '1'(309). It is confirmed whether processing for all packet classification rules finished(310). If processing for all packet classification rules was completed, a tree is generated(311).
Abstract:
PURPOSE: A method for searching, creating and deleting a node in an MIT(Management Information Tree) using a multiple-balanced tree structure is provided to reduce a process load that is generated if the MIT is represented as a binary tree structure. CONSTITUTION: An input of a distinguished name as a search target is received(100). A root node of the MIT is searched, and then it is determined whether the root node exists(101). If the root node does not exist, a search failure is declared and a search procedure is ended(102). A child sub-tree of the root node is searched if the root node exists(103). If the child sub-tree thereof exists, a node corresponding to a relative distinguished name is searched in the child sub-tree(104). It is determined whether the relative distinguished name of the searched node is a final relative distinguished name which forms the distinguished name(105). If the relative distinguished name thereof is the final one, a value of the searched node is reported(106). If the relative distinguished name thereof is not the final one, the child sub-tree is searched again, and then the node corresponding to the relative distinguished name is searched repeatedly(102-105).
Abstract:
1. 청구범위에 기재된 발명이 속한 기술분야 본 발명은 통신 시스템을 위한 특정 시점에서의 유일한 식별자 생성 방법에 관한 것임. 2. 발명이 해결하려고 하는 기술적 과제 본 발명은, 각각의 기능이 온라인으로 수행되고 사용자의 시스템 이용에 따라 동적으로 수행되어 전체적으로 균형을 이루면서 고루 빠른 시간내에 수행될 수 있도록 하는 통신시스템을 위한 특정 시점에서의 유일한 식별자 생성 방법을 제공하고자 함. 3. 발명의 해결방법의 요지 본 발명은, 식별자를 생성하기 위한 초기 준비 시간, 새로운 식별자를 생성하는 시간, 어떤 식별자가 현재 사용되고 있는지를 알아보는데 소요되는 시간, 사용이 완료된 식별자를 소멸시키는 시간, 및 식별자를 생성하는 기능을 소멸시키는 시간들을 현실적인 범위내에서 가능한 빠른 시간내에 수행하여 특정 시점에서 유일한 식별자를 생성한다. 4. 발명의 중요한 용도 본 발명은 통신망 시스템등의 식별자 생성에 이용됨.